SHY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

847 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F (SHY)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$14.2B — down 6% from $15.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 120 funds opened new SHY positions and 72 closed out — a net gain of 48 holders — while 324 added to existing stakes and 293 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$268M. The largest seller was AssetMark Inc, cutting an estimated $318M.
